Historical Context of the Original Name

Lady Antebellum launched in 2006, with their name evoking the pre-Civil War South. While initially intended to reflect Southern romance and musical heritage, the term "antebellum" gradually became controversial due to its ties to slavery and oppression.

As conversations about race and representation grew, the band reconsidered how their name was perceived, leading to internal discussions about aligning their identity with modern values of inclusion.

Industry Impact and Fan Response

The name change prompted widespread discussion across media and social platforms, highlighting the band's influence and the weight of naming in popular culture. While some fans expressed nostalgia for the original name, many appreciated the move toward clarity and respect.

Over time, the band's consistent output and transparent communication helped solidify acceptance and focus attention back on their music.
